Google Android: “Hallo Welt” in 30 Minuten

Während die Entwicklung mobiler Anwendung für das iPhone nicht gerade trivial sein soll, können Apps für Google Android dank JAVA- und XML-Grundkenntnisse bereits innerhalb kurzer Zeit realisiert werden. Ich habe mir dies ein mal für das bekannte “Hallo Welt”-Beispiel angesehen und die Schritte hier mitgeschrieben.

Android programmieren: Vorbereitung

  1. Zunächst benötigt man eine Entwicklungsumgebung  (falls noch nicht vorhanden): Eclipse Classic 3.4.1
  2. Nun wird das Android Software Development Kit (SDK) heruntergeladen und entpackt
  3. Das Plugin ADT macht Eclipse für die Android-Entwicklung fit und kann direkt aus Eclipse installiert werden. (siehe hier)
  4. Schließlich wird in Eclipse unter “Windows, Preferences, Android” der Pfad zum entpackten SDK angegeben

Android Hallo Welt

  1. Jetzt kann ein erstes Android-Projekt erzeugt werden: Unter “File, New, Project…” wählt man “Android Project” aus und klickt auf “Finish”.
  2. Als Resultat erhält man das Grundgerüst einer Android-Anwendung:
    android3

    src: enthält den Quellcode der Anwendung
    res/layout:  ein einfacher UI-Editor.  Per Online GUI Editor können später weitere grafische Elemente per XML hinzugefügt werden.
    res/values:  Zeichenketten werden ausgelagert. Dies erleichtert eine spätere Internationalisierung enorm.
  3. Als nächstes wird der Quellcode wie hier (“Construct the UI”) beschrieben angepasst.

Android-Emulator

  1. Im mitgelieferten Emulator kann man sich nun das Ergebnis ansehen. Einmalig muss dafür eine “Run Configuration” (“Run, Run Configurations…, Android”) erstellt werden, die künftig wie von Eclipse gewohnt über die Menüleiste aufgerufen werden kann.
  2. Nach einigen Minuten ist das virtuelle Android-System hochgefahren und die erstellte Anwendung öffnet sich im Emulator.
    clipboard05

Fazit

Respekt. Zwar hat dieses Beispiel praktisch keine Funktionalität, jedoch weckt die fast nicht vorhandene Einstiegshürde Lust auf mehr. Statt sich mit dem Einrichten der Entwicklungsumgebung rumzuplagen, kann man sich besser auf die Architektur von Android konzentrieren und direkt mit dem Programmieren beginnen: und das (zunächst) ohne eine Zeile per Konsole eingeben zu müssen. ;) Auf der offiziellen Android-Seite findet man zunächst eine gute Architekturübersicht. Außerdem sind die Mythen zu Android, JavaFX und J2ME sehr interessant!

7 Responses to “Google Android: “Hallo Welt” in 30 Minuten”

  1. @wuestenigel Says:

    #Google #Android: “Hallo Welt” in 30 Minuten programmieren – http://tinyurl.com/acx3le

  2. @lennarz Says:

    Ich empfehle #Android Programmieren ist easy: http://tinyurl.com/acx3le

  3. @gphonenews Says:

    Google Android: “Hallo Welt” in 30 Minuten » wuestenigel.com …: Während die Entwicklung mobiler Anwendung für .. http://tinyurl.com/acx3le

  4. @wuestenigel Says:

    Welches wäre die nächste Stufe für einen Einsteiger in der Android-Programmierung? "Hallo Welt" läuft bereits ;) http://tinyurl.com/acx3le

  5. Phil Says:

    Habe mir das “Hello World” inzwischen auch zu Gemüte geführt ;)
    Mal schaun ob ich die Zeit finde, etwas tiefer einzusteigen.

  6. @CemB Says:

    Google #Android: “Hallo Welt” in 30 Minuten http://tinyurl.com/acx3le Schritt für Schritt #Linktipp

  7. @gphonenews Says:

    Google Android: “Hallo Welt” in 30 Minuten http://tinyurl.com/acx3le

Leave a Reply

Verwandte Suchbegriffe:

android programmieren, android programmierung, android entwicklung, android hallo welt, programmieren für android, android entwicklungsumgebung, android entwickler, für+android+programmieren